The seat-sharing talks between Congress and the Samajwadi Party (SP) in Uttar Pradesh have fallen through, sources told India Today TV. The breakdown in negotiations, which occurred late on Monday night, was primarily due to disagreements over the allocation of three crucial seats in the Moradabad division. However, on this episode of To the Point, spokespersons of the Congress and Samajwadi Party seemed confident of finalising the seat-sharing formula before the poll dates for Lok Sabha elections are announced.
